The objective of the Marietta Square Farmers Market (MSFM) is to support the development of the local agricultural economy which will foster stewardship of our land and goodwill in our community by: providing a place for farmers/growers to sell their goods directly to consumers, assisting business who sell food, farm, garden and kitchen related products which make use of locally grown ingredients gain entry into the local market and a place that will provide alternative shopping and bring together people from all walks of life from throughout our community.

Open each Saturday morning from January through December, 2020. Market customers have lots of variety to choose from including heirloom tomatoes, fruits and vegetables that are rarely, if ever, available from the grocery store. We also have lots of staples such as potatoes, onions, tomatoes, squash and beans in addition to pattypan squash, heirloom salad mix, amazing cut flower arrangements,local honey,herbal soap, whole grain breads, fudge pies, jelly,jam and preserves.
